2009 Chrysler Aspen vs. 2004 Dodge Caravan

To start off, 2009 Chrysler Aspen is newer by 5 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2004 Dodge Caravan.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2004 Dodge Caravan would be higher. At 5,653 cc (8 cylinders), 2009 Chrysler Aspen is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Chrysler Aspen (345 HP @ 5300 RPM) has 165 more horse power than 2004 Dodge Caravan. (180 HP @ 5600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2009 Chrysler Aspen should accelerate faster than 2004 Dodge Caravan.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 Chrysler Aspen weights approximately 169 kg more than 2004 Dodge Caravan.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2009 Chrysler Aspen is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2004 Dodge Caravan.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2009 Chrysler Aspen will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Chrysler Aspen (515 Nm) has 230 more torque (in Nm) than 2004 Dodge Caravan. (285 Nm). This means 2009 Chrysler Aspen will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2004 Dodge Caravan.
